Magnesium Hydroxide Vs. Magnesium Oxide | Livestrong

When magnesium oxide reacts with water, which has the chemical formula H2O, the resulting compound is Mg(OH)2, or magnesium hydroxide. As such, you can have a suspension of magnesium hydroxide in water, but you can't have a suspension of magnesium oxide in water—it would simply turn into magnesium hydroxide. Magnesium oxide is a white powder.

The Parts of the Periodic Table - Angelo State University

Magnesium oxide, MgO, is used in refractory bricks that are capable of withstanding the high temperatures in fireplaces and furnaces (magnesium oxide melts at 2800 °C). Magnesium sulfate heptahydrate, MgSO 4 ·7H 2 O, better known as Epsom salt, is a muscle relaxant and a mild laxative.

The lattice enthalpies of calcium oxide and magnesium ...

Differences in size of an ionic lattice are directly linked to differences in how exothermic the lattice enthalpy of a salt is. Mg 2+ has a smaller radius than Ca 2+ and thus a higher positive charge density.. This results in a stronger affinity for the negative O 2- ions.

Magnesium oxide | MgO - PubChem

. Magnesium oxide (MgO). An inorganic compound that occurs in nature as the mineral periclase. In aqueous media combines quickly with water to form magnesium hydroxide. It is used as an antacid and mild laxative and has many nonmedicinal uses.

Magnesium Oxides - an overview | ScienceDirect Topics

The primary difference between the processes is that the magnesium oxide process is regenerative, whereas lime scrubbing is generally a throwaway process. The magnesium oxide process, shown in Figure 9.5, uses a slurry of slaked magnesium oxide (Mg(OH) 2 ) to remove SO 2 from the flue gas forming magnesium sulfite and sulfate via the basic ...

Beryllium, Calcium and Magnesium: Properties, Uses ...

Magnesium (Mg)(Z = 12) The first person to recognise that magnesium was an element was Joseph Black at Edinburgh in 1755. He distinguished magnesia (magnesium oxide, MgO) from lime (calcium oxide, CaO) although both were produced by heating similar kinds of carbonate rocks, magnesite and limestone respectively. The name was coined from Magnesia.

Why is the difference in the melting point of aluminium ...

Magnesium ions and oxygen ions also have small ionic radius. Magnesium is in period 3 so its ion is smaller than that of calcium or barium. Oxygen ion is smaller than sulfide and fluoride. The smaller the ionic radii, the smaller the bond length and the stronger the bond. Therefore the ionic bond between magnesium and oxygen is very strong.
